SnapManager Oracle
本繁體中文版使用機器翻譯,譯文僅供參考,若與英文版本牴觸,應以英文版本為準。

使用SMO cmd檔案命令

貢獻者

如果主機上的Shell限制了命令列上可顯示的字元數、您可以使用cmd檔案命令來執行任何命令。

語法

        smo cmdfile
-file file_name
\[-quiet \| -verbose\]

您可以將命令包含在文字檔中、然後使用SMO cmd檔案命令來執行命令。您只能在文字檔中新增一個命令。您不得在命令語法中包含SMO。

註 使用SMO cmd檔案命令取代了SMO pfile命令。SMO cmd檔案與SMO pfile命令不相容。

參數

  • 檔案file_name

    指定包含您要執行之命令的文字檔路徑。

  • -無聲

    指定主控台僅顯示錯誤訊息。預設為顯示錯誤和警告訊息。

  • -詳細

    指定錯誤、警告和資訊訊息會顯示在主控台中。

範例

此範例將設定檔create命令加入位於/tmp.的command.txt中、即可建立設定檔。然後您可以執行SMO cmd檔案命令。

文字檔包含下列資訊:

profile create -profile SALES1 -repository -dbname SNAPMGRR
-login -username server1_user -password ontap -port 1521 -host server1
-database -dbname SMO -sid SMO -login -username sys -password oracle -port 1521
-host Host2 -osaccount oracle -osgroup db2

您現在可以使用command.txt檔案執行SMO cmd檔案命令來建立設定檔:

smo cmdfile -file /tmp/command.txt